Breaking out the VPN to see the video, they are using FORS AI Image enhancement on this release.
Not sure what to think about this yet until I see some more results, but Kawamori is seen in the remastering studio again like he was with the DYRL release.

I ordered from CDJapan, but paid via PayPal; didn't run into a fraud alert...

As for my experience with the video --- there are certain scenes when I can notice jagged lines (aliasing?) where I'd expect them to be smooth.  (I know, not very scientific at all... :P)  One place I remember noticing this is in the first episode, when  Shin first meets Sara, and Mao.   But I'm also watching this like 3 feet away, on a Sony M9 monitor, using a PS5 to play the discs...

Anyway, I'm glad to have these on physical media + english subtitles... :)

 

edit:

I can't notice the jaggies on the backgrounds / "matte paintings", but they're definitely present on foreground elements I daresay on every scene.  And once you know they're present, you'll just see them everywhere.  😕

edit 2:

The motion blurs you see when following aircraft are also pixellated.
